In this intimate biography, F. B. Sanborn—a close friend of his subject—incorporates letters and family documents, excerpts from Thoreau’s journal, and his own experiences with Thoreau and his family to develop a vivid portrayal of this American icon.

About the author

Franklin Benjamin Sanborn (1831-1917) was an American journalist, author, and reformer. He studied the social sciences and had a particular interest in American transcendentalism; in fact, Sanborn wrote biographies of many of the movement’s most important figures, such as Emerson and Thoreau.
